Understanding Anterolisthesis: Symptoms, Causes, and Treatment Options

Anterolisthesis is a spinal condition characterized by abnormal forward or backward displacement of a vertebra relative to the one below it. This misalignment predominantly affects the lower back, leading to various symptoms and potential complications. Recognizing the causes, symptoms, and available treatment methods is essential for effective management and improved quality of life.

Signs and Symptoms
The severity and location of the vertebral slip determine the symptoms, which often include persistent lower back pain that can extend to the legs. This discomfort may hinder mobility and daily activities, increasing the risk of muscle weakness, reduced bone density, and joint stiffness over time. Common signs include:

Chronic muscle spasms

Burning, tingling, or numbness in the affected area

Loss of sensation to hot or cold stimuli

Muscle weakness throughout the body

Postural changes and persistent discomfort

In severe cases, individuals may experience difficulty walking or performing daily tasks, and some may encounter bladder or bowel function issues requiring medical attention.

Causes of Anterolisthesis
This condition often results from trauma such as fractures, falls, or accidents. Intense physical activities like bodybuilding can also contribute. Age-related degeneration is another common factor, weakening spinal ligaments and joints, leading to vertebral instability—a condition known as degenerative spondylolisthesis. Tumors in the spine can displace vertebrae, increasing the risk. Rarely, genetic predispositions in children may lead to developmental spinal disorders persisting into adulthood.

Treatment Strategies
Treatment options depend on the degree of vertebral slippage, underlying causes, symptoms, and spinal stability observed via X-ray. Typically, treatments are tailored to severity: mild cases may only require pain management, while severe cases may necessitate surgery.

Rest and Stabilization
Limiting physical activity and bed rest help prevent further vertebral displacement. Rest allows the spine to recover and minimizes additional damage.

Physical Therapy and Exercise
Targeted physical therapy and exercises improve mobility, strengthen back muscles, and enhance flexibility. Supportive devices like back braces may be recommended to reduce pain and provide stability.

Surgical Intervention
When conservative methods are ineffective and vertebral slippage worsens, surgery is considered. Techniques include spinal fusion, which stabilizes the spine by fusing bones with grafts, or decompression, which removes tissues pressing on nerves. Devices such as screws or rods may be used to secure the vertebrae in place.
